Choosing the Perfect Steak

The foundation of a great smoked steak lies in selecting the right cut. For this endeavor, the New York strip steak reigns supreme. Known for its robust flavor and tender texture, this cut is characterized by its thick, well-marbled meat. Look for steaks that are at least 1 inch thick and have a good amount of marbling throughout.

Seasoning to Perfection

Once you have your steak, it’s time to elevate its flavor with a carefully crafted blend of seasonings. A classic steak rub consisting of sal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and smoked paprika will impart a savory and aromatic crust. Alternatively, you can experiment with your own unique spice combinations to create a personalized flavor profile. Be sure to apply the rub generously to both sides of the steak, allowing it to penetrate the meat.

Preparing Your Pellet Grill

Pellet grills offer the convenience of precise temperature control and a consistent smoke flavor. Before firing up your grill, ensure that it is clean and well-maintained. Use high-quality hardwood pellets for optimal smoke production and flavor. Set the grill temperature to 225-250°F (107-121°C) for a slow and controlled smoking process.

Smoking the Steak

Place the seasoned steak directly on the grill grate over indirect heat. Avoid placing it directly over the flame to prevent flare-ups and charring. Close the lid and insert a meat thermometer into the thickest part of the steak. Smoke the steak for approximately 2-3 hours, or until the internal temperature reaches 110-115°F (43-46°C) for medium-rare.

Resting for Tenderness

Once the steak has reached the desired internal temperature, remove it from the grill and let it r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ing and serving. This resting period all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at, resulting in a more tender and flavorful steak.

Finishing with a Sear

For a perfect finishing touch, sear the steak over direct heat for 1-2 minutes per side. This will create a flavorful crust while maintaining the juicy interior. Be sure to monitor the internal temperature closely to ensure that the steak does not overcook.

Slicing and Serving

Once the steak has rested and seared, it’s time to savor the fruits of your labor. Slice the steak against the grain into thin strips and serve immediately with your favorite sides. Consider pairing it with roasted vegetables, mashed potatoes, or a tangy chimichurri sauce for a complete culinary experience.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What type of wood pellets should I use for smoking New York strip steak?
A: For optimal flavor, use hardwood pellets such as hickory, oak, or apple.

Q: Can I smoke the steak on direct heat?
A: No, avoid direct heat as it can cause flare-ups and charring. Place the steak over indirect heat for a slow and controlled smoking process.

Q: How long should I rest the steak before slicing?
A: Rest the steak for 10-15 minutes before slicing to allow the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ender steak.

Q: Can I smoke other cuts of steak on a pellet grill?
A: Yes, pellet grills are versatile and can be used to smoke a variety of steak cuts, such as ribeye, filet mignon, and flank steak.

Q: How do I clean the pellet grill after smoking?
A: After the grill has cooled down, remove the ash from the burn pot and vacuum any remaining pellets from the grill. Clean the grill grate with a wire brush.

Q: What sides go well with smoked New York strip steak?
A: Roasted vegetables, mashed potatoes, grilled corn, and a tangy chimichurri sauce are all excellent accompaniments to smoked New York strip steak.
